Bane of Piridon

The Bane of Piridon, a notorious band of highwaymen, has long been the scourge of the trade routes threading through the rocky valleys of Piridon.   Led by the cunning and elusive Solomon Lepus, this gang is as enigmatic as it is feared. His second-in-command is a fierce warrior known only as The Hare—a title that pays homage to Solomon’s own name.   The gang’s signature is leaving a single, silver coin on the eyes of those they rob, a calling card that has become synonymous with dread for travellers. They are selective in their targets, preying primarily upon dignitaries and the elite, which has earned them a begrudging respect among the poorer common folk. Their actions, though unlawful, speak to a deeper struggle within the region.   After a robbery went awry, many of the members were imprisoned and tried for their crimes.
